Skip to content

Criar e disponibilizar a página de política de atualização (crossmark) #419

@robertatakenaka

Description

@robertatakenaka

Descrição da tarefa

Criar condicionalmente a página do crossmark.

Subtarefas

  • Crie uma função que crie uma página, ou seja, crie registro em Pages (opac_schema), com os dados de CrossmarkPage, mas somente se a url está ausente ou segue o padrão https://domain/j/journal_acron/update_policy/
  • Crie o template correspondente para apresentar a página que está condicionada à existência de Pages correspondente.
  • Crie condicionalmente o link para a página de política de atualização abaixo do link de Política editorial do menu
<div class="col-3 pt-5">
        <div class="list-group d-print-none mb-5">
          
            <a class="list-group-item" href="http://mc04.manuscriptcentral.com/mioc-scielo" target="_blank"><span class="material-icons-outlined">launch</span> Submissão de manuscritos</a>
          
            <a class="list-group-item" href="/journal/mioc/about/#about"><span class="material-icons-outlined">info</span> Sobre o periódico</a>
            <a class="list-group-item" href="/journal/mioc/about/#item-2"><span class="material-icons-outlined">article</span> Política editorial</a>
            <a class="list-group-item" href="/journal/mioc/about/#editors"><span class="material-icons-outlined">people</span> Corpo Editorial</a>
            <a class="list-group-item" href="/journal/mioc/about/#instructions"><span class="material-icons-outlined">help_outline</span> Instruções aos autores</a>
            <a class="list-group-item" href="/journal/mioc/about/#contact"><span class="material-icons-outlined">markunread</span> Contato</a>

      </div>
    </div>
  • Aproveite para trocar /journal/mioc/about/#item-2 por /journal/mioc/about/editorialpolicy

Metadata

Metadata

Labels

Type

No type

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ions